Gobbler Cakes.
I had some leftover smoked turkey with lots of trimmings left. I used 2 cups of diced turkey. 4 cups cooked turkey stuffing. 1 cup dried cranberries, 2 eggs, and a little mayo. Mixed well and patted out. Crushed corn flakes for the crust. Fried and topped with creamy mushrooms. I two and my son had four. They were great, like Thanksgiving in every bite. Thanks for looking.
